Five things about Adequate Yearly Progress by Roxanna Elden 5/5⭐️s 

1. A book about teaching by a teacher. 
2. At times funny…mostly because it’s so true. 
3. Full of archetypal teachers and administrators but also so relatable. 
4. It’s fiction…but it’s also “based on a true story”. The true story of educators all over this country. 
5. I really enjoyed this. I think non-teachers would enjoy it too but might not fully comprehend the honest representation within its pages. It reads like something dystopian…but it’s reality now for so many teachers.
